The subsidiary of Functional Technologies Phyterra Yeast has submitted to the USFDA a generally recognized as safe (GRAS) notification for its acrylamide-preventing (AP) yeast.

The yeast is considered for GRAS for use in reducing asparagine levels and thereby preventing the formation of acrylamide during heat-related processing of a variety of foods including grain- and vegetable-based food products such as breads, biscuits, processed potato products, crackers and cereals.
